How It Works To achieve Qurator recognition, businesses can be evaluated in as many as six categories: Environment, Cultural Support, Equity, Safety, Community and Guest Experience. Among the most recent to receive Elite certification is SCP Hilo, a 128-room property with meeting space for up to 40 attendees, on the Island of Hawai’i.

ADMEI's Emergency Preparedness Certificate Course (EPCP) defines Risk Management as “the identification, analysis, assessment, control and avoidance, minimization, or elimination of unacceptable risks.” Anyone involved in the planning and/or execution of meetings and events will benefit from earning this certificate.

Virginia Green Certification Virginia Green was launched in 2007, created to encourage green practices in the state’s tourism industry. Qualifications for certification include sustainability commitment related to recycling, waste reduction, water, energy, communication and signage.

In 2013, it became the first venue in the world to receive APEX/ASTM Level 2 Certification in 2013, meaning the convention center adheres to comprehensive standards for environmentally sustainable meetings.
